What Makes Fipronil Spot-On an Effective Choice for Continuous Flea and Tick Protection?
The chemical makeup of fipronil is what makes it so effective at killing parasites over and over again. As a phenylpyrazole pesticide, fipronil works by attacking the gamma-aminobutyric acid (GABA) receptors in the nervous systems of insects. This specific targeting breaks down chloride ion channels, which causes neurons to fire without control, paralysing and killing parasites that are vulnerable. Because of how precisely this process works, fipronil affects the nervous systems of invertebrates while having little to no effect on neurotransmitter routes in mammals. This makes it a safe drug for pets.


Formulation science is a key part of making safety last longer. Good fipronil spot-on products have carefully picked carrier liquids that help with both the initial penetration and long-term release. When the mixture is put on the skin between the shoulder blades, it moves through the sebaceous glands and forms a reserve in the fatty layer below the skin's surface. Over the next few weeks, this dermal depot slowly releases the active ingredient onto the hair coat and skin, keeping therapeutic amounts that kill new bugs.
That fipronil is lipophilic makes it stay in the skin area longer. Fipronil stays in sebaceous secretions because it sticks to fatty tissues, unlike water-soluble compounds that wash away easily. Studies show that the amount of fipronil in the top layer of lipids stays above the minimum levels needed for effectiveness for at least 30 days after a single application. This pharmacokinetic advantage is what makes monthly administration schedules work to keep fleas and ticks from coming back, even when people are constantly exposed to flea and tick populations.

How Does Fipronil Spot-On Maintain Parasite Control Through Its Mode of Action?
Fipronil is different from systemic insecticides that need to feed on blood before they can kill bugs because it works on contact. Fleas and ticks can get lethal doses just by walking over hair and skin that has been treated. This contact mechanism kills parasites before they finish feeding on blood, which lowers the risk of disease transmission from pathogen-carrying vectors. According to research, fipronil starts to kill fleas four to eight hours after it is applied, and most fleas die within 24 hours of coming into contact with treated animals.


Continuous surface activity is caused by fipronil being released over and over again from sebum stores. Fipronil molecules are carried to the hair shaft and skin surface by lipid fluids, which are made by dogs' skin. This self-renewing distribution system keeps killing insects even as the environment wears away the top layer. Protective levels stay high during the dosing period because of the dynamic balance between reservoir storage and surface refilling. This balance makes up for the slow breakdown and mechanical removal through grooming or outdoor contact.
The multiple stages of action against flea life processes make security last longer. The most attention is paid to flea adults, but the immature stages are just as dangerous to controlling parasites. Fipronil has ovicidal qualities that stop flea eggs laid on cats that have been treated from hatching into larvae. By stopping the reproductive processes, the environment is less likely to become contaminated with new parasites. This stops the circle of re-infestation that many pet owners find frustrating. Fipronil is an important part of controlling parasites in the home because it kills adult parasites and stops them from reproducing.


Controlling ticks also works well with similar long-lasting methods. Different types of ticks attach at different rates. For some, it takes several hours to make a secure attachment site. Ticks can't survive where fipronil is on the skin and hair because it makes them uncomfortable while they're exploring, before they bite and start eating. This action before connection adds an extra layer of defence against tick-borne diseases, since ticks usually need to feed for a long time before the pathogens can move from tick to host.
The Importance of Fipronil Spot-On in Sustained External Parasite Management
Environmental parasite loads change with the seasons, making some times of the year more likely to be infested. Fleas are more likely to breed in the spring and summer because the warmer weather speeds up their growth processes. A single pet that hasn't been treated for fleas can quickly become overrun by flea populations that are growing at an exponential rate during these busy times. Applying fipronil spot-on once a month keeps up protective walls that stop breeding populations from forming on pets, even when weather conditions are at their toughest.
Different areas have different levels of parasites, so control strategies need to be flexible. Fleas are active all year long in coastal areas with mild winters, so protection schedules must be kept up all the time. Different species of ticks live in different places. Some species like to live in wooded areas, while others do better in fields or urban parks. Fipronil's broad-spectrum activity against multiple parasite species gives pets a wide range of protection, regardless of the ectoparasite profiles in their area. This makes planning preventive care easier for pet owners in many places.
Keeping parasites under control is harder for homes with multiple pets.
When defence on one animal wears off, parasites can spread more quickly when pets are infected with each other. Treating all pets at the same time with successful products like fipronil-based spot-ons forms a protective barrier around the whole family. This coordinated approach keeps treated animals from getting parasites from their friends who haven't been treated. This makes the money spent on parasite prevention more effective.
How Pet Care Strategies Influence the Long-Term Performance of Fipronil Spot-On
How the product is applied has a big effect on how well it works and how long it protects. By parting the hair and applying the solution directly to the skin instead of the fur, the solution is more likely to get into the oil glands. The best place to put it on is usually between the shoulder blades, where pets can't easily lick it off. This keeps pets from removing it too soon through cleaning habits. Following the manufacturer's instructions on how much to apply based on the pet's weight strikes the best balance between safety and effectiveness, making sure there is enough coverage without too much.


Bathing plans and spot-on product longevity affect each other in ways that need to be planned out in advance. Washing your hair and skin too often, especially with harsh detergents, can remove the protective oils that are on them. If you wait 48 hours after applying the product before bathing, it has time to fully absorb and spread out across the lipid layer. Taking baths no more than once a week or less during the protection time helps keep surface amounts high. When bathing is necessary, using light soaps made for pets keeps the lipid-based delivery system from getting messed up as much as possible.
Using other skin products at the same time should be thought about so that they don't affect the spread of fipronil. Heavy coat conditioners or grooming sprays used right after spot-on application may create barriers that make it harder for the product to absorb. If you wait a few days between using spot-on treatments and facial grooming products, the protective reserve has time to build up before you add substances that might interfere with it. By talking to vets about product fit, pet owners can plan complete care routines that protect against parasites without sacrificing effectiveness.


Managing the environment in addition to treating the animals themselves can help lower the total parasite load. When you hoover your rugs and furniture regularly, you get rid of flea eggs and larvae, which are where new adult fleas live. Flea eggs and larvae that are hiding in pet bedding can be killed by washing it once a week in hot water. Ticks don't like living near people when their yards are well-kept, the grass is trimmed, and leaves are picked up. These combined methods make it easier for treated pets to stay free of parasites, which means that fipronil spot-on products can keep working better with less pushback.
Enhancing Daily Pet Protection with Fipronil Spot-On Flea and Tick Defense Solutions
By spotting the first signs of an infection early on, you can take action before the parasite population grows too large. Too much scratching, hair loss, or visible flea dirt (fleas' digested blood) are all signs of established infestations that need to be treated right away. Finding ticks while brushing is a sign of exposure to the surroundings and the chance of getting a disease. Pet owners who keep a close eye on their pets can quickly spot these warning signs and make sure their pets are always safe by sticking to regular fipronil spot-on treatment plans.


The best way to choose a product and use it depends on the specifics of your pet. Different breeds' coats affect how products are spread, and people with thick double coats may need to pay more attention to making sure the product gets all the way to the skin when they apply it. Age is important because young animals may need carefully made goods with different amounts of active ingredients. Health state is taken into account when figuring out how safe something is, especially for cats whose liver or kidneys don't work well enough to break down drugs properly. To make parasite avoidance methods more effective for each animal, veterinary advice is needed to deal with these factors.
Keeping an eye on the environment helps you prepare for times when you need to be extra careful. Patterns of weather that help parasites grow, like warm temperatures and enough humidity, mean that there is a higher chance of spread. When travelling to areas with different parasite populations, pets may be exposed to species that aren't common where they live, so it's important to talk to a vet about the best ways to protect them. Knowing about local disease outbreak reports lets people make changes to their prevention plans before they happen, protecting pets from new threats in their areas.


Long-term health benefits go beyond getting rid of parasites right away. Flea allergy dermatitis is a hypersensitivity condition that causes severe itching and skin damage from allergic reactions to flea saliva. It can be avoided by keeping fleas away. Lyme disease, ehrlichiosis, anaplasmosis, and other dangerous diseases spread by ticks that affect both people and pets can be avoided with good tick control. Animal friends and family members who might otherwise come into contact with parasites or zoonotic diseases are protected by regular fipronil spot-on use, which stops diseases from spreading.

1. How quickly does fipronil spot-on begin protecting pets after application?

Fipronil spreads through sebum glands to skin and hair surfaces within hours of being properly applied. This is when it starts to work. Usually, the best surface concentrations are reached within 24 to 48 hours, giving the most protection. By not bathing during the first few days, the product has a chance to fully settle into the dermal lipid layers before it is exposed to water. This helps keep the protection level consistent over the 30-day dosing period.
2. Can fipronil spot-on be used with other medicines for prevention?

Topical treatments based on fipronil usually work well with oral medications that treat internal parasites or prevent heartworms. The different way it works and the fact that it is applied externally keep interactions with drugs that are given through the body to a minimum. Talking to a vet before mixing different preventative products is the safest and most effective way to make sure that complete parasite control plans are coordinated and fit the health needs of each pet and the risks of exposure to the environment.
3. What factors might reduce the effectiveness of fipronil spot-on treatments?

Absorption into sebum glands is limited when the product is applied incorrectly, especially when it is put on hair instead of skin. A lot of washing with harsh shampoos removes protective layers before the full safety time is over. Different animals may have different amounts of sebum production, skin thickness, and metabolic rates, which may affect how long the medicine works for them. Consistent monthly application schedules and following product-specific instructions are the best ways to protect a wide range of pet populations.
